Tel Aviv... A normal day...


Just woke up, opened the shades and discovered a beautiful blue sky. It is Tel Aviv almost 9am. Rockets are falling in Beer Sheva. Israeli soldiers are fighting in Gaza and I am getting ready for a normal Sunday in Tel Aviv. Here Sunday is the first day of the week. People pick-up a warm cup of coffee from one of the hundreds coffee shops in the city before heading to work. Since I work for a Dutch Company this is a free day for me. My first appointment is at 10.30 at the Ministry of Absorption. I hope it will not take too long so that I can enjoy the rest of the day strolling on the "tayelet" - promenade - sit for a cup of coffee,read the newspaper. Stephane and I will also probably go to the "shoek ha karmel" - market in order fill up our fridge with fresh fruits and vegetables. Later we will meet with our Belgian friends - Brigitte and Doron. They return to Brussels tonight. A normal day in Tel Aviv. Except that the TV is on almost 24/7... We do not want to miss any news about the war. I will call my family in Beer Sheva to make sure they're alright. Yesterday I checked where the nearest shelter is located. Now I know and I can just go on with my normal Sunday in Tel Aviv.
